Item 5.07 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ders.
(a) The 2024 annual shareholders meeting of Empire State Realty Trust, Inc. (the “Company”) was held on May 9,                                                 
2024.                        

(b) The Class A and Class B common stockholders of the Company (i) elected all of the Company’s nominees for director, (ii) approved, on a non-binding advisory basis, the compensation of the Company’s named executive officers, (iii) approved the Empire State Realty Trust, Inc. Empire State Realty OP, L.P. 2024 Equity Incentive Plan and (iv) ratified the selection of Ernst & Young LLP as the Company’s independ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2024. The results of the meeting were as follows:

With respect to the preceding matters, holders of Class A common stock were entitled to one vote per share, and holders of Class B common stock were entitled to 50 votes per share, so long as such Class B common stockholder continued to own 49 operating partnership units in Empire State Realty OP, L.P. for each such share of Class B common stock. Holders of Class A common stock and Class B common stock voted together as a single class on the matters covered at the meeting, and their votes were counted and totaled together.
